当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

java web部署到服务器,Java Web应用部署至云服务器的详细指南与优化策略

java web部署到服务器,Java Web应用部署至云服务器的详细指南与优化策略

Java Web应用部署至服务器及云服务器的指南包括:选择合适的服务器环境,配置Java运行时环境,打包应用,使用Tomcat等服务器软件进行部署,配置虚拟主机和端口映...

Java Web应用部署至服务器及云服务器的指南包括:选择合适的服务器环境,配置Java运行时环境,打包应用,使用Tomcat等服务器软件进行部署,配置虚拟主机和端口映射,确保安全性,优化性能(如缓存、连接池等),以及定期监控和更新,以确保应用的稳定性和高效运行。

随着互联网技术的不断发展,Java Web应用已经成为了企业级应用开发的主流,为了提高应用的性能、安全性和稳定性,越来越多的企业选择将Java Web应用部署到云服务器,本文将详细阐述Java Web应用部署至云服务器的步骤、注意事项以及优化策略。

Java Web应用部署至云服务器的步骤

1、选择合适的云服务器

根据企业需求选择合适的云服务器,云服务器提供商有很多,如阿里云、腾讯云、华为云等,在选择云服务器时,需要考虑以下因素:

java web部署到服务器,Java Web应用部署至云服务器的详细指南与优化策略

(1)计算能力:根据应用负载选择合适的CPU核心数和内存大小。

(2)存储空间:根据数据存储需求选择合适的硬盘类型和容量。

(3)网络带宽:根据应用访问量选择合适的公网带宽。

(4)地域:根据用户地理位置选择合适的云服务器地域,降低延迟。

2、安装Java环境

在云服务器上安装Java环境,以下是安装Java环境的步骤:

(1)下载Java安装包:前往Oracle官网下载Java安装包。

(2)解压安装包:将下载的安装包解压到指定目录。

(3)配置环境变量:在Windows系统中,编辑“系统属性”中的“环境变量”设置;在Linux系统中,编辑“/etc/profile”文件。

(4)验证Java环境:在命令行中输入“java -version”命令,查看Java版本信息。

3、安装Tomcat服务器

(1)下载Tomcat安装包:前往Apache官网下载Tomcat安装包。

java web部署到服务器,Java Web应用部署至云服务器的详细指南与优化策略

(2)解压安装包:将下载的安装包解压到指定目录。

(3)配置Tomcat:编辑“/usr/local/tomcat/conf/server.xml”文件,修改端口号、JVM参数等。

(4)启动Tomcat:在命令行中输入“/usr/local/tomcat/bin/startup.sh”命令,启动Tomcat服务器。

4、部署Java Web应用

(1)将Java Web应用打包成WAR文件。

(2)将WAR文件上传到Tomcat的“/webapps”目录下。

(3)在Tomcat中部署应用:在“/usr/local/tomcat/conf/server.xml”文件中添加以下配置:

<Context path="/your-app" docBase="/path/to/your/war/file" />

5、测试应用

在浏览器中输入应用的访问地址,测试应用是否正常运行。

三、Java Web应用部署至云服务器的注意事项

1、网络安全:配置防火墙规则,只允许必要的端口访问。

2、数据备份:定期备份数据,以防数据丢失。

java web部署到服务器,Java Web应用部署至云服务器的详细指南与优化策略

3、日志管理:配置日志文件,便于问题排查。

4、负载均衡:根据应用访问量,配置负载均衡策略。

5、自动化部署:使用自动化部署工具,提高部署效率。

四、Java Web应用部署至云服务器的优化策略

1、优化Java虚拟机参数:根据应用负载调整JVM参数,提高性能。

2、使用缓存技术:如Redis、Memcached等,减少数据库访问压力。

3、优化数据库性能:使用索引、分区等技术,提高数据库访问速度。

4、使用静态资源压缩:将CSS、JavaScript、图片等静态资源进行压缩,减少传输数据量。

5、使用CDN:将静态资源部署到CDN,降低延迟,提高访问速度。

6、定期监控:使用监控工具,实时监控应用性能,发现问题及时处理。

本文详细阐述了Java Web应用部署至云服务器的步骤、注意事项以及优化策略,通过合理配置云服务器、优化应用性能,可以提高Java Web应用的稳定性、安全性和访问速度,希望本文对您的Java Web应用部署有所帮助。

黑狐家游戏

发表评论

最新文章